Best Practice to record Tax amount from external system

Summary:

Hello Experts,

We are currently using an internal billing system that calculates tax amounts externally, outside of Oracle. As part of our Invoice integration process, we would like to ensure that tax amounts are accurately recorded in Oracle Receivables.

Given that tax is not being calculated within Oracle, we would like to confirm the best practice for recording these externally calculated tax amounts. Can we go with below?

  • Creating a new memo line with Type “Line” to represent the tax amount.
  • Treating this tax line as a standard line item, since Oracle is not performing the tax calculation.

Could you please confirm if this is an acceptable and recommended approach? If not, could you advise on the best method to record externally calculated tax amounts in Oracle Receivables
